Monthly Unitary Charge means the Unitary Charge in respect of each Payment Period which is calculated by dividing the Unitary Charge for the relevant Contract Year by the number of days in that Contract Year to derive a daily unitary charge. The resultant daily unitary charge is then multiplied by the number of days in that month.
